Entity: SISTER
SISTER is a term that refers to a female sibling or a close female friend. It can also have slang meanings, such as a fellow gay man among the LGBTQ+ community.

Etymology
The term 'sister' originates from Old English, meaning a female sibling.
Definition
SISTER is commonly used to refer to a female sibling or a close female friend. In slang, it can also denote a fellow gay man within the LGBTQ+ community.
Historical Context
Throughout history, the concept of sisterhood has been celebrated in various cultures, symbolizing familial bonds and solidarity among women.
Cultural Significance
SISTER holds cultural significance as a term that represents the bond between female siblings and close female friends. It also plays a role in LGBTQ+ communities as a term of endearment and camaraderie.
